An Advanced Certificate in Advanced Biomaterials for Implants equips participants with the specialized knowledge and skills needed to design, develop, and evaluate novel biomaterials for implantable medical devices. This intensive program focuses on the latest advancements in biomaterial science and engineering, directly impacting the medical device industry.
Learning outcomes include a comprehensive understanding of biocompatibility testing, tissue engineering principles relevant to implant design, and regulatory pathways for medical device approval. Students gain hands-on experience through practical laboratory sessions, working with cutting-edge biomaterials like polymers, ceramics, and composites commonly used in orthopedic, cardiovascular, and dental implants. The program also explores the biomechanical properties and degradation mechanisms of biomaterials within the human body.

Advanced Certificate in Advanced Biomaterials for Implants signifies a crucial step in addressing the burgeoning demand for innovative medical solutions. The UK’s ageing population and increasing prevalence of chronic diseases fuel this demand, creating numerous opportunities for biomaterials experts. According to the NHS, the number of hip replacements performed annually in England exceeds 100,000, highlighting the significant market for advanced biomaterials in implantable devices. This escalating need necessitates professionals with specialized knowledge in biocompatibility, biomechanics, and the latest advancements in materials science.
